West Tisbury Elementary School reported an enrollment of 334 students for the 2025-26 school year, data from the Massachusetts Department of Elementary and Secondary Education show.
This figure represents a 4% increase over the prior year, when enrollment reached 321 students.
Boys accounted for 55.1% of the 2025-26 student body, while girls made up 44.9%.
The data indicate that white students comprised 73.1% of West Tisbury Elementary’s total enrollment for 2025-26.
The school operates within the Up-Island Regional School District, whose main office is based in Vineyard Haven.
